What Are the Possible Side Effects of LIPO-B?
Side Effects Overview
Lipo-B is generally well-tolerated. The most frequently reported issue is localized to the injection site.
Localized Reactions (Most Common)
Injection Site Sensitivity The most frequently reported issue. This includes mild redness, swelling, or a "bruised" sensation at the site of administration.
Contact your care team if you experience:
- Reactions that do not resolve within a few hours.
- Signs of infection at the injection site (increasing redness, warmth, swelling, or discharge).
- Any unexpected symptoms after beginning your protocol.
